Overview
The Church of Santa Maria at San Satiro is a historic church in Milan, Italy, known for its stunning Renaissance architecture and a famous trompe-l'œil choir. It is a must-visit for architecture enthusiasts.
The church is renowned for its architectural brilliance, particularly the illusionistic choir created by Bramante, which is a marvel of Renaissance engineering.
